Common Waterproofing Techniques
There are numerous frequent techniques useful for waterproofing properties and surfaces. Probably the most widespread procedures is the appliance of waterproof coatings or membranes. These coatings are placed on surfaces which include roofs, partitions, and foundations to produce a barrier versus h2o. Waterproof coatings may be constructed from a number of elements, which includes bitumen, acrylics, polyurethane, and rubber. A further common means of waterproofing is using sealants and caulks. These products are applied to joints, seams, and gaps in surfaces to stop h2o from seeping as a result of. Sealants and caulks in many cases are utilized together with other waterproofing methods to provide supplemental security.
In combination with coatings and sealants, waterproofing will also be achieved in the utilization of drainage programs. These devices are meant to redirect h2o faraway from structures and surfaces, avoiding it from creating problems. Typical types of drainage units incorporate gutters, downspouts, French drains, and sump pumps. One more approach to waterproofing will be the set up of watertight membranes or obstacles beneath surfaces like foundations or basements. These membranes produce a barrier against water and prevent it from seeping into the creating. All round, there are lots of frequent ways of waterproofing which might be used to protect buildings and surfaces from water destruction.
Waterproofing for various Surfaces
Distinctive surfaces demand distinct ways to waterproofing. One example is, roofs tend to be waterproofed employing coatings or membranes which are developed to resist publicity to The weather. These coatings are usually placed on the surface area from the roof and supply a protecting barrier versus drinking water. Walls can be waterproofed making use of related approaches, and also throughout the utilization of sealants and caulks to fill in gaps and joints. Foundations and basements are sometimes waterproofed using membranes or limitations which can be installed beneath the area to forestall water from seeping in.
Besides these prevalent surfaces, There's also specialized waterproofing strategies for distinct areas for instance swimming pools, decks, and balconies. These parts have to have Distinctive interest to make sure that they remain watertight and resistant to water damage. For example, swimming pools are frequently waterproofed making use of specialized coatings or membranes that are designed to face up to exposure to chlorine as well as other chemicals. Decks and balconies may demand extra defense against humidity and UV publicity, which may be achieved from the use of specialised sealants and coatings. Over-all, unique surfaces require unique methods to waterproofing in order to deliver helpful protection towards water injury.

Signals Your Property Requires Waterproofing
There are numerous symptoms that reveal a assets can be in need of waterproofing. One popular indication would be the presence of drinking water stains or discoloration on walls or ceilings, which can indicate that h2o is seeping in to the building. One more signal is the presence of mould or mildew development, that may indicate surplus humidity infiltration. Furthermore, musty odors or perhaps a moist feeling from the air can reveal that there's a moisture issue within a constructing.
